WebMar 2, 2024 · For tax year 2024, the maximum eligible expense for this credit is $8,000 for one child and $16,000 for two or more. Depending on their income, taxpayers could write off up to 50% of these expenses. For the purposes of this credit, the IRS defines a qualifying person as: A taxpayer's dependent who is under age 13 when the care is provided. WebAug 31, 2024 · The Tax Cuts and Jobs Act raised the child tax credit from $1,000 to $2,000 per qualifying child for tax years 2024 through 2025. The TCJA also significantly expanded the phase-out threshold for credit eligibility, beginning the phase-out where modified adjusted gross income (MAGI) exceeds $400,000 for MFJ and $200,000 for other …

This goes up to £1,000 every 3 months if a child is … good hooks for papersWebJul 1, 2024 · Under the new guidelines, any Kansas worker who makes 250% or less of the federal poverty level is now eligible for childcare assistance. The expansion also includes waiving the family share deduction for essential workers and reducing the deduction for all others. Families also will see an expanded eligibility period from six to 12 months. good hooks for literary analysis essaysWebMar 11, 2011 · Child Care Rebate.
